Compare App Builders: Best AI & No-Code Platforms in 2024
Choosing the right app builder can make or break your project. With dozens of platforms claiming to be the "best," comparing app builders has become essential for developers, entrepreneurs, and businesses looking to create apps efficiently. Whether you're a non-technical founder building your first MVP or a seasoned developer seeking faster prototyping tools, this comprehensive comparison will help you find the perfect platform.
The app building landscape has evolved dramatically, with AI-powered tools and sophisticated no-code platforms transforming how we create applications. From simple drag-and-drop interfaces to advanced code generators, today's app builders offer unprecedented capabilities for users at every skill level.
Understanding Different Types of App Builders
Before diving into specific comparisons, it's crucial to understand the main categories of app builders available today:
AI Code Generators like Lovable.dev and Bolt.new create actual code that developers can edit and deploy independently. These platforms excel at generating React, TypeScript, and other modern frameworks while maintaining code quality and customization options.
No-Code Platforms such as Bubble, Softr, and traditional builders focus on visual development without requiring programming knowledge. Users drag and drop components to create functional applications with built-in hosting and deployment.
Low-Code Solutions bridge the gap between no-code simplicity and full development flexibility. Microsoft Power Apps and similar platforms offer visual interfaces while allowing custom code integration when needed.
Hybrid AI Assistants like Replit Agent combine coding environments with AI assistance, supporting multiple programming languages and deployment options while maintaining developer control.
Top App Builders Detailed Comparison
AI-Powered Code Generators
Lovable.dev stands out for React and TypeScript development, offering exceptional code quality and clean UI generation. The platform integrates seamlessly with Supabase for backend functionality, making it ideal for developers building web MVPs quickly. However, users must handle their own deployment, and the platform is somewhat dependent on the Supabase ecosystem.
Bolt.new provides impressive framework flexibility, supporting React, Vue, and Svelte with a smooth in-browser development experience. The platform excels at generating highly customizable code but requires external deployment solutions, making it more suitable for experienced developers.
Replit Agent offers autonomous development capabilities with over 30 integrations and multi-platform deployment options, including app stores. While less design-focused than some alternatives, it supports any programming language and provides robust cloud IDE functionality.
No-Code and Low-Code Leaders
Bubble remains a powerhouse for scalable MVP development, offering visual workflows, extensive plugins, and both web and mobile capabilities. The platform can hit capacity limits with complex applications but provides mature, reliable hosting solutions.
Softr excels at rapid development from spreadsheet data, featuring pre-built blocks and exceptional ease of use. However, it offers limited pixel-perfect control, making it better suited for data-driven applications than highly custom designs.
Microsoft Power Apps integrates deeply with the Microsoft 365 ecosystem, providing enterprise-grade security and AI editing capabilities. The platform works best for organizations already invested in Microsoft's infrastructure but can create vendor lock-in.
Key Factors to Consider When Comparing App Builders
Technical Requirements and Complexity
Your technical background significantly impacts which app builder will work best. Developers comfortable with code should consider AI generators like Lovable.dev or Bolt.new for maximum flexibility and code ownership. Non-technical users benefit more from platforms like Softr or Bubble that handle technical complexity behind intuitive interfaces.
Deployment and Hosting Options
Some platforms provide integrated hosting (Bubble, Softr), while others generate code requiring separate deployment (Lovable.dev, Bolt.new). Consider your long-term hosting needs, scalability requirements, and whether you prefer managed solutions or deployment flexibility.
Integration Capabilities
Modern apps rarely exist in isolation. Evaluate each platform's integration ecosystem:
- API connectivity for third-party services
- Database options and data management
- Authentication systems and user management
- Payment processing integration
- Analytics and monitoring capabilities
Customization vs. Speed Trade-offs
No-code platforms typically offer faster initial development but may limit customization as your app grows. AI code generators provide ultimate flexibility but require more technical knowledge and setup time.
Enterprise and Business Considerations
Security and Compliance
Enterprise applications need robust security features. Platforms like Microsoft Power Apps and Knack offer HIPAA compliance and enterprise-grade security. Evaluate each platform's:
- Data encryption and storage policies
- User authentication and access controls
- Compliance certifications (SOC 2, GDPR, etc.)
- On-premises deployment options
Scalability and Performance
Consider how each platform handles growth:
- User limits and concurrent usage
- Database performance at scale
- API rate limits and quotas
- CDN and global distribution capabilities
Team Collaboration Features
Modern app development often involves multiple stakeholders. Look for platforms offering:
- Multi-user editing and version control
- Role-based permissions for different team members
- Review and approval workflows
- Documentation and commenting systems
Cost Analysis and Pricing Models
Subscription vs. Usage-Based Pricing
App builders employ various pricing strategies:
- Fixed monthly subscriptions with feature tiers
- Usage-based billing for API calls or active users
- One-time licenses for self-hosted solutions
- Freemium models with limited features or usage
Hidden Costs to Consider
- Hosting and infrastructure expenses
- Third-party integrations and API costs
- Custom development for advanced features
- Migration costs if switching platforms
Platform-Specific Strengths and Use Cases
Best for Rapid Prototyping
For quick MVP development, Lovable.dev scores exceptionally high with clean React code generation and fast iteration cycles. Softr excels for data-driven prototypes that need to be live quickly.
Best for Production Applications
Bubble offers the most mature hosting infrastructure for production apps, while Replit Agent provides excellent deployment flexibility across multiple platforms including app stores.
Best for Enterprise Integration
Microsoft Power Apps dominates enterprise scenarios with deep Office 365 integration, while Reflex.build serves Python-focused teams needing on-premises deployment.
Best for Cross-Platform Development
Bolt.new supports multiple frontend frameworks, making it ideal for teams working across different technology stacks. Replit Agent supports virtually any programming language for ultimate flexibility.
Emerging Trends in App Building
AI-First Development
2024 has seen a shift toward AI-autonomous development, with platforms like Replit Agent offering increasingly sophisticated code generation and problem-solving capabilities. This trend reduces development time while maintaining code quality.
Multi-Modal Interfaces
Modern app builders increasingly support voice commands, visual design uploads, and natural language programming, making app development accessible to broader audiences.
Integrated DevOps
Platforms are incorporating CI/CD pipelines, automated testing, and monitoring directly into their development environments, streamlining the path from prototype to production.
Making Your Decision: A Practical Framework
Step 1: Define Your Requirements
- Technical expertise of your team
- App complexity and feature requirements
- Target platforms (web, mobile, desktop)
- Timeline and development speed needs
- Budget constraints and pricing preferences
Step 2: Test Multiple Platforms
Most app builders offer free tiers or trials. Test 2-3 platforms with a simple version of your actual project to compare:
- Development speed and ease of use
- Code quality (for AI generators)
- Customization options and flexibility
- Documentation and community support
Step 3: Consider Long-term Implications
- Vendor lock-in risks and migration paths
- Scalability limitations and upgrade options
- Community size and platform longevity
- Support quality and response times
Frequently Asked Questions
What's the difference between no-code and AI code generators?
No-code platforms like Bubble create applications through visual interfaces without generating editable code, while AI code generators like Lovable.dev produce actual code files that developers can modify and deploy independently. No-code offers simplicity but limits customization, while AI generators provide flexibility but require technical knowledge.
Which app builder is best for beginners?
Softr and Bubble are excellent choices for beginners due to their intuitive drag-and-drop interfaces and extensive documentation. Softr particularly excels for simple data-driven apps, while Bubble offers more advanced capabilities as skills develop.
Can I migrate my app between different builders?
Migration difficulty varies significantly between platforms. AI code generators like Lovable.dev and Bolt.new produce portable code that's easier to migrate, while no-code platforms often create proprietary structures that require rebuilding when switching.
How do AI app builders compare in terms of code quality?
Lovable.dev consistently generates high-quality React and TypeScript code with clean architecture, while Bolt.new offers excellent flexibility across multiple frameworks. Replit Agent provides good code quality with superior deployment integration.
What's the typical cost range for app builders?
Pricing ranges from free tiers to enterprise solutions costing thousands monthly. Most platforms offer starter plans between $10-50/month, with professional tiers ranging $100-500/month. Enterprise solutions often require custom pricing based on usage and features.
Which platforms offer the best mobile app development?
Bubble provides strong mobile web capabilities, while Replit Agent offers native app store deployment. For true native mobile development, consider specialized platforms or hybrid approaches combining web builders with mobile frameworks.
Conclusion
Comparing app builders reveals no single "perfect" solution—the best choice depends entirely on your specific needs, technical expertise, and project requirements. AI code generators like Lovable.dev excel for developers wanting clean, editable code, while no-code platforms like Bubble and Softr serve non-technical users building functional applications quickly.
For 2024, the trend clearly favors AI-enhanced development with platforms offering increasing automation while maintaining developer control. Whether you choose a sophisticated AI generator or a user-friendly no-code solution, success depends on matching platform capabilities to your team's skills and project goals.
Start with free trials of your top 2-3 candidates, build a simple version of your actual project, and evaluate based on development speed, customization options, and long-term scalability. The app building landscape continues evolving rapidly, making hands-on testing the most reliable way to find your ideal platform.